The Weirdest Christmas Movies and TV Specials Ever Made
Over the years, many Christmas-themed movies and TV specials have danced across big and small screens. Some of them are classics like A Muppet Christmas Carol, or It’s a Wonderful Life. Others go out of their way to try and be extreme in their counter-programming, like Silent Night, Deadly Night (which has somehow made six total films over the years…good lord).
And then others are just so odd and unexpected that they deserve their own list, and that’s what we’re doing today. I’m not sure this list should be counted as Nice or Naughty; we’ll say this is Jessica’s Weird List…which, if you know me, is a compliment.
This list isn’t in any particular order…except for the last one I’ll cover because it manages to trump everyone on the sheer weirdness that it worked to be. Also, I do not include any of the Hallmark massive, Fort Knox-sized library of films because……you’ll have to strap me into a chair like that one from A Clockwork Orange to get that to happen.
So buckle up as we climb on Santa’s sleigh to fly through some of the oddest entries in the land of Christmas entertainment, including Star Wars, Mr. T as Santa, Dudley Moore as a Christmas Elf, Pac-Man, the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les and more.
